There is one answer to your question in Maple's post.
There will be some Canadians for sure, but I doubt many to begin with as the size of the game/level ready pool of players is limited. There is a North American talent search road show starting tomorrow (28th) that is visiting Vancouver, Detroit, Chicago, Pittsburgh, Philadelphia, Montreal, Boston and Toronto, and you will see a few names come from that. It is vital going forward that Canadians break more and more into the squad, but good results (and entertaining rugby) will be a must, to attract an ongoing and growing fan base. Because of that I believe that the first season will be very result driven and therefore out of necessity right now, lead to a very familiar group of first team squad players to the British Rugby League fans.
